Summary
Artificial urinary sphincters offer a viable solution for persistent stress urinary incontinence when other treatments fail. Careful patient selection and surgical technique are key to successful outcomes with this device.

Context:
- Stress urinary incontinence (SUI) remains a significant challenge in urological practice.
- The artificial urinary sphincter (AUS) represents a reconstructive option for managing SUI.
- Literature review from 1974-1999 provides historical and current insights into AUS technology.
Purpose:
- To comprehensively review the literature on artificial urinary sphincters.
- To detail the function, implantation techniques, indications, outcomes, and complications of AUS.
- To evaluate the utility of AUS in treating stress incontinence.
Summary:
- The AMS-800 is the current standard artificial urinary sphincter.
- Excellent results are achievable with correct patient selection and meticulous perioperative management.
- Complications, though reduced with design improvements, include urethral atrophy, erosion, infection, and bladder instability.
Impact:
- Artificial urinary sphincters provide a valuable treatment option for patients with refractory stress urinary incontinence.
- Successful outcomes depend on appropriate patient selection and surgical expertise.
- Ongoing research into new prototypes aims to further minimize complications and improve efficacy.
